Staff report shows county property sales progress; supervisors press for treasurer briefing on tax-delinquent properties
Summary
Economic development staff provided a property-inventory update showing active listings, pending sales and closings largely to owner-occupants; supervisors pressed for the treasurer to explain why many properties remain tax-delinquent and to provide a district-level list of properties eligible for foreclosure.
Emily Streff, project manager in Economic Development, presented the county’s property-inventory update, reporting two active listings, three properties being prepared for listing and six pending transactions. Streff said most recent closings have been to owner-occupants or first-time homebuyers; one property is being rehabilitated to FHA guidelines for eventual sale…
